E Ink displays are generally within e-readers such as for instance Amazon's Kindle and Barnes & Noble's Nook. These shows use digital ink technology that mimics the looks of printer on paper. On one other hand, LCD (Liquid Crystal Display) displays are utilized in many pills and smartphones today.
One of the major benefits of Elizabeth Printer exhibits is their low power consumption. Unlike LCD displays that need a consistent backlight to produce images, E Ink just uses power when adjusting what is shown on screen. Which means E Printer devices can last weeks as well as weeks about the same demand compared to only a few hours by having an LCD screen.
Yet another good thing about E Printer features is their readability in brilliant light conditions. The matte end and lack of backlighting allow it to be simpler to see text on an Elizabeth Ink screen actually under direct sunlight without any glare or reflections. That makes them well suited for outdoor reading or working.
On the other hand, LCD monitors present more lively colors and sharper photos in comparison to E ink notepad. They likewise have quicker refresh costs which will make them suited to seeing movies or playing games with fast-moving graphics.
Nevertheless, extended experience of brilliant light from an LCD screen could cause attention strain and weakness due to its large contrast levels and flickering backlighting technology. This is especially problematic if you may spend extended hours using your tablet every day.
More over, studies have shown that E Printer features are less inclined to trigger vision stress and fatigue compared to LCD screens. E Printer technology works on the reflective area that does not emit gentle, making it more much like reading from a real book. This makes Elizabeth Printer shows a better choice for long-term tablet use, especially for people who spend hours reading or focusing on their devices.
